ISABELLE MARIE DREW
Wake service for Isabelle Marie Drew, 104 of Minco was held on Friday, March 2, 2007, 7 pm at the Huber-Benson Chapel in El Reno 100 S. Barker with Deacon Lloyd Menz officiating. The funeral mass was held on Saturday, March 3, 2007 10 am at the St. Josephs Catholic Church in Union City with Rev. Francis Nyugen of the church officiating. Burial followed at the St. Josephs Catholic Cemetery in Union City under the direction of Huber-Reynolds Funeral Home of Minco.
Isabelle Marie Drew was born August 17, 1902 at Union City to George and Mary Ann (Horning) Schumacher and she passed away on Wednesday, February 28, 2007 at El Reno.
She was raised in Union City and after marrying moved to Minco till death. Mrs. Drew was a member of the St. Josephs Catholic Church and attended St. Josephs Catholic School in Union City as a child. She married James Gilbert “Gib” Drew in 1924.
She was preceded in death by: Parents: George and Mary Ann Schumacher; Husband: Gib, June 3, 1976; one daughter: Gladys Reichert; one son: James Drew; two brothers: Bob and Pete Schumacher; four sisters: Pat Hanniman, Sister Agnes Schumacher, Rose Schumacher and Jack Harris; two great granddaughters: Fallon Haffner and Jaqueline Jill Watson.
Survivors include: One son and daughter-in-law: Charles and Glenda Drew of Weatherford, Texas; one daughter and son-in-law: Agnes and Jim Halley of Minco; 15 grandchildren; 37 great grandchildren; 12 great great grandchildren.
